STATEN ISLAND, N.Y. — Perennially one of the go-to spots for Trick-or-Treaters on Staten Island, this year once again Harvest Avenue didn’t disappoint with hundreds of costumed kids and parents flocking to the tree-lined West Brighton street as it transformed into a Halloween haven of candy and decorations Tuesday afternoon.
